Scranton, PA - Marywood University improved to 12-4 in Colonial States Athletic Conference softball action with a pair of five-inning wins over the College of Notre Dame (MD) Saturday afternoon in Scranton.  Marywood (16-10 overall) beat the Gators 10-1 in the opener while Kaitlyn Jones threw a complete-game one-hitter for Marywood as part of a 12-0 win.

After Notre Dame (4-13, 1-10 CSAC) opened the scoring in the opener in the top of the first when Kirsten Smulovitz scored, Marywood tied the game in the bottom half of the inning then exploded for nine runs over the next two to take a commanding, 10-1 lead.  With Alexandra Stine (3-1) on the mound, Marywood cruised to the win from there as the freshman hurler struck out eight Gators while only allowing four hits on the day.

One and two hitters Kim Lope and Meghin Palmer each went 3-for-3 in the opener with Palmer picking up a team-high three RBIs and Lope belting two triples.  Shawna Sandy was 2-for-3 with a double while Kaitlyn Brennan was 1-for-3 with a double and and RBI.

Palmer again led the Pacers in the nightcap, going 2-for-2 with an RBI and two runs scored  as Marywood got out to a 7-0 lead after one and added five more in the second.  Jones pitched a complete game one-hit performance while striking out five.  Brennan was 2-for-2 in the nighcap with a three-run homer and four RBI total.

Marywood will host Immaculata University Monday afternoon at 3:00 pm in CSAC action.
